What is Brisca?
Brisca is a classic 2-player Spanish trick-taking card game played with a 40-card Spanish deck. The goal is to score 61 or more points by winning tricks. A trump suit is revealed at the start and changes the value of each trick.

How does the ELO system work in Brisca?
You start with a rating of 1200. After each match, your rating goes up or down based on the outcome and the strength of your opponent. Beating a stronger opponent earns more points than beating a weaker one.
